Detailed analysis regarding kalshi and the evolving world of event contracts
The financial landscape is constantly evolving, and with it, the methods people use to speculate and hedge against risk. One increasingly prominent area of innovation is the realm of event contracts, and a company at the forefront of this development is kalshi. This platform allows users to trade on the outcome of future events, ranging from political elections to economic indicators and even natural disasters. It represents a fundamentally different approach to prediction markets, offering a regulated and centralized exchange for these types of contracts.
Traditional prediction markets often operate in gray areas legally, relying on decentralized platforms and trust-based systems. Kalshi, however, operates under the regulatory oversight of the Commodity Futures Trading Commission (CFTC), offering a level of security and transparency that is lacking in many other platforms. This regulated environment is key to its growing acceptance and potential for mainstream adoption. The concept hinges on the idea that the collective wisdom of crowds can accurately forecast future events, and by facilitating this process, Kalshi aims to provide valuable insights and opportunities for both individual traders and institutional investors.
Understanding the Mechanics of Event Contracts
Event contracts, as facilitated by platforms like Kalshi, are essentially agreements that pay out a predetermined amount based on whether a specific event occurs or not. Unlike traditional futures contracts that are tied to underlying commodities or assets, event contracts are tied to the binary outcome of an event – it either happens or it doesn't. The price of a contract fluctuates based on supply and demand, reflecting the market’s probability assessment of the event occurring. If you believe an event is more likely to happen than the market suggests, you can buy contracts, hoping to sell them for a profit if the event comes to fruition. Conversely, if you believe an event is unlikely, you can sell contracts, aiming to profit if the event doesn’t occur.
The Role of Liquidity and Market Participants
The efficiency of an event contract market is heavily dependent on liquidity, meaning the ease with which contracts can be bought and sold. Higher liquidity generally leads to tighter bid-ask spreads and more accurate price discovery. Kalshi actively works to attract a diverse range of market participants, from individual traders and professional investors to institutions seeking to hedge their exposure to specific risks. The presence of informed traders and sophisticated analytical tools helps to improve the quality of price signals and reduce the potential for manipulation. A key component of this is the ability to trade small contract sizes, making it accessible to a wider range of participants.

The Regulatory Landscape and Kalshi's Approach
The regulation of prediction markets has been a contentious issue for years. While proponents argue that they can provide valuable information and improve decision-making, regulators have often expressed concerns about potential manipulation and gambling-like behavior. Kalshi's success hinges, in large part, on its proactive engagement with the CFTC and its commitment to operating within a well-defined regulatory framework. This approach has allowed it to sidestep some of the legal hurdles faced by other prediction market platforms. By registering as a Designated Contract Market (DCM) with the CFTC, Kalshi is subject to strict rules regarding market surveillance, clearing, and settlement.
Navigating the Legal Challenges
Obtaining regulatory approval wasn’t a simple process for Kalshi. It required demonstrating to the CFTC that its platform could operate with integrity, prevent market abuse, and protect investors. This involved implementing robust risk management systems, conducting thorough due diligence on participants, and providing clear disclosures about the risks associated with event contracts. The regulatory scrutiny has also forced Kalshi to adapt and refine its platform over time, leading to a more secure and transparent trading environment. The ongoing dialogue with regulators is critical to ensuring that Kalshi can continue to innovate and expand its offerings.

The Potential Applications of Event Contracts Beyond Speculation
While event contracts are often viewed as a speculative trading tool, their potential applications extend far beyond simple financial gain. They can be used for a variety of purposes, including risk management, forecasting, and data collection. For example, companies can use event contracts to hedge against the risk of unforeseen events that could impact their business, such as natural disasters or political instability. Researchers can use them to gather insights into public opinion and predict the outcome of future events. The versatility of event contracts makes them a valuable tool for a wide range of stakeholders.

Current Trends and Future Outlook For Event Contracts
The event contract market is still relatively young, but it is growing rapidly. As more people become aware of the benefits of these contracts, demand is expected to increase. One key trend is the expansion of the types of events that are being offered for trading. Initially, the focus was primarily on political and economic events, but now platforms like Kalshi are offering contracts on a wider range of topics, including sports, entertainment, and even climate change. This diversification is attracting a broader audience and increasing the overall market size.
Another trend is the increasing sophistication of trading strategies. As the market matures, traders are developing more advanced algorithms and analytical tools to identify profitable opportunities. The integration of artificial intelligence and machine learning is also expected to play a significant role in the future of event contract trading. The ability to process large amounts of data and identify subtle patterns could give traders a competitive edge. The future looks promising for this emerging asset class.
Expanding Applications in Corporate Risk Management
Beyond individual trading and broad forecasting, event contracts present a novel approach to corporate risk management. Consider a company heavily reliant on a specific supply chain originating from a region prone to geopolitical instability. Instead of traditional insurance or complex hedging strategies, the company could utilize Kalshi to trade contracts tied to the probability of disruptions – such as port closures or trade sanctions in that region. A favorable outcome on these contracts effectively offsets the financial impact of a supply chain interruption. This allows for a more precise and dynamic risk transfer mechanism than traditional methods.
Furthermore, businesses facing regulatory uncertainty can similarly leverage event contracts to mitigate financial exposure. For example, a pharmaceutical company awaiting FDA approval for a new drug could trade contracts based on the likelihood of approval by a specific date. This provides a tangible financial instrument linked to a critical business event, offering a proactive risk management tool. This proactive approach can transform potential financial risks into tradable positions, allowing companies to better navigate an increasingly complex world.
